Quantification of fiber distance distribution with in-house software: (A) representative raw image data shown as z-projection of the Col1 fibers (red) in a hypoxic (green) region; (B) representative example of software detection of hypoxic cells (green in raw image (A)) independent of fluorescence intensity and threshold of raw images; preprocessing using the filter (C) to identify fiber-like objects (red) among various non-fiber-like objects in the image to produce (D) the corresponding Col1 fiber image; (E) computing the distances three-dimensionally to the surrounding fibers from each voxel to determine the nearest distance to a fiber. The fiber volume is computed as an additional parameter.
